Core Services Offered by Veterinary Clinics

A quality veterinary clinic delivers care for each part of your pet’s life. The fundamentals include vaccinations, flea and tick prevention, and guidance on what to feed them. That’s the basis. But clinics also must have tools to diagnose when something’s wrong. This means on-site lab tests and digital x-rays. They carry out surgeries, from routine sterilizations to more complex operations, using modern anesthesia and monitoring gear. Many clinics have also added services like dental cleanings, grooming, and behavior tips. The goal is to handle most of your pet’s needs in one convenient place.

Preventative Care and Wellness Plans

Preventing a problem before it starts is always superior than treating it later. Wellness plans put that concept into practice. These plans usually bundle important services—yearly shots, routine blood tests, dental cleanings—into a single annual schedule. For owners, it turns variable vet bills into a affordable monthly or yearly cost. It also acts as a checklist, so no key part of your pet’s preventative care gets missed. Following a plan means you’re working directly with your vet on a long-term health strategy, which can minimize scary emergencies and foster a stronger partnership with the clinic.

Why you need Regular Veterinary Check-ups

View regular vet exams as the bedrock of your pet’s health. These go beyond quick look-overs. They’re detailed consultations that give your vet a clear picture of what’s normal for your dog or cat. During a routine visit, the vet checks weight, auscultates the heart and lungs, inspects teeth, and evaluates overall body condition. They often detect small shifts in health that even an attentive owner might not see. Finding a problem early usually results in a simpler, more affordable fix. Maintaining these check-ups is one of the best ways to help your pet live a longer, more active life.

Advanced Veterinary Care Available

Similar to human doctors, vets can concentrate in particular fields. These cover skin experts (dermatologists), heart specialists (cardiologists), cancer doctors (oncologists), and internal medicine vets. These practitioners undergo years of extra training. There are circumstances where a referral to one of these specialists proves invaluable, delivering targeted treatments a general vet might not. Your primary vet manages the overall picture, but their relationship to these specialists ensures your pet can get expert care for complicated health issues.

Financial Aspects and Animal Health Coverage

Let’s go over money. Veterinary care is a significant portion of the cost of keeping a pet. It’s smart to ask about standard fees and get quotes for planned procedures upfront. This is where animal health insurance has grown in popularity. For a monthly fee, it can reduce the burden of a serious injury or illness. But you need to read the policy details. Examine carefully at what’s covered, the claim limits, the out-of-pocket amount you pay, and what illnesses are left out. Select a plan that fits your finances and gives you practical protection for your dog or cat’s care.

Emergency Care and After-Hours Support

Pets fall ill or injured at the least opportune times, often when your regular clinic is shut. Understanding what to do in an urgent situation before it occurs is a key part of being a animal guardian. Your regular practice should explain their out-of-hours procedure. Some have urgent care vets on call; others collaborate with a specialized veterinary hospital. Make it a point to find out where to go, who to call, and what to anticipate. In a critical situation, those valuable minutes make a difference. Being prepared gets your pet essential care faster.
